Taxonomic Classification
| Rank | Agami Heron | plaster beetle |
|---|---|---|
| Kingdom same | Animalia (Animals) | Animalia (Animals) |
| Phylum | Chordata (Chordates) | Arthropoda (Arthropods) |
| Class | Aves (Birds) | Insecta (Insects) |
| Order | Pelecaniformes (Pelecaniformes) | Coleoptera (Beetles) |
| Family | Ardeidae | Latridiidae |
| Genus | Agamia | Cartodere |
| Species | Agamia agami | Cartodere bifasciata |
